Economize 20% hoje mesmo Use o código WELCOME ao finalizar a compra. BEM-VINDO

Como usar IA no desenvolvimento do servidor FiveM

Libere o potencial do seu servidor FiveM com inteligência artificial

Gerenciar um servidor FiveM de sucesso é desafiador. Engajar jogadores, gerenciar comunidades, combater trapaceiros e desenvolver novos conteúdos exige muito tempo e esforço. E se você pudesse usar a tecnologia para lidar com parte do trabalho pesado? Inteligência Artificial (IA) não é mais ficção científica; é um conjunto de ferramentas práticas que podem automatizar tarefas, aprimorar a experiência dos jogadores e fornecer insights para ajudar seu servidor a prosperar.

Este guia explora maneiras concretas pelas quais a IA pode resolver desafios comuns do servidor FiveM, indo além do exagero para oferecer estratégias acionáveis que você pode implementar.


1. Automatize o suporte e a integração do jogador com chatbots de IA

O problema: Os administradores passam horas incontáveis respondendo às mesmas perguntas básicas no Discord ou no jogo: "Como me inscrevo para o DP?", "Onde fica a garagem mais próxima?", "Quais são as regras para roubos?". Esse suporte repetitivo consome um tempo valioso.

A solução de IA: Implante um chatbot com inteligência artificial treinado especificamente para as informações do seu servidor. Este bot pode:

  • Forneça respostas instantâneas para perguntas frequentes, 24 horas por dia, 7 dias por semana.
  • Oriente novos jogadores sobre regras essenciais do servidor, recursos e etapas iniciais.
  • Liberte sua equipe administrativa e de suporte para se concentrar em questões complexas, engajamento da comunidade e desenvolvimento.

Exemplo de implementação: Existem ferramentas que permitem que você alimente seu servidor com regras, guias e Perguntas frequentes documentos em um modelo de IA. Isso cria um assistente virtual experiente para seus jogadores.

Impacto no mundo real: Um administrador de servidor relatou uma redução significativa (mais de 70%) em tickets de suporte de rotina após integrar um chatbot de IA dedicado, permitindo que sua equipe se concentrasse em melhorar os recursos do servidor em vez de perguntas e respostas repetitivas.

Pronto para automatizar o suporte? Desenvolvemos uma ferramenta de IA para comunidades FiveM. Saiba mais e experimente aqui.


2. Aumente a segurança com anti-cheat com tecnologia de IA

FiveM Antifraude

O problema: Trapaceiros que usam hacks sutis ou em constante evolução podem ignorar os sistemas anti-trapaça tradicionais baseados em assinaturas, frustrando jogadores legítimos e prejudicando a reputação do servidor.

A solução de IA: Os sistemas anti-cheat orientados por IA focam na análise comportamental. Eles aprendem os padrões de jogabilidade normal (movimento, precisão de tiro, ganho de recursos, atividade de rede) e sinalizam anomalias que indicam trapaça, mesmo para hacks nunca antes vistos. Essa abordagem pode detectar:

  • Aimbots sutis ou triggerbots.
  • Truques de velocidade ou teletransporte.
  • Atividade econômica incomum ou geração de itens.
  • Tentativas de manipulação de rede.

Ferramentas e abordagens:

  • Explore projetos de código aberto como FogoAC (requer conhecimento técnico para implementar e manter).
  • Desenvolva scripts personalizados do lado do servidor que monitorem as principais métricas dos jogadores e usem análise estatística ou modelos de aprendizado de máquina para detectar valores discrepantes (avançado).
  • Procure soluções antifraude de terceiros emergentes que incorporem elementos de IA.

Dica profissional: A IA anti-cheat eficaz depende de bons dados e aprendizado contínuo. Embora poderosa, a implementação requer ajustes cuidadosos para minimizar falsos positivos. Alguns servidores que usam análises comportamentais avançadas notaram uma redução drástica em cheats bem-sucedidos e apelações de banimento relacionadas.


3. Crie mundos mais imersivos com NPCs mais inteligentes

okok talktonpc

ok TalkToNPC

O preço original era: $18.99.O preço atual é: $8.99.

Informações:

  • A câmera é posicionado automaticamente e girado de acordo com a posição do NPC e rotação (basicamente você só precisa definir as coordenadas e o rumo do NPC);
  • Você pode configurar para 6 opções/ações (é possível e fácil adicionar mais se quiser, é só me mandar uma mensagem);
  • okokTextUI o script pode ser desabilitado simplesmente definindo Config.OkokTextUI = false no arquivo de configuração;
  • o tempo de animação pode ser facilmente alterado no arquivo de configuração;
  • o minimapa está oculto por padrão ao interagir com um NPC (é possível desativá-lo no arquivo de configuração).

No arquivo de configuração você pode para definir:

  • NPC que você quer gerar;
  • Nome do NPC (que aparece no topo da interface);
  • Mensagem de diálogo do NPC;
  • Coordenadas NPC e rotação;
  • intervalo de interação (quão perto você precisa estar para interagir com eles);
  • opções exibidas na interface e qual evento eles desencadeiam;
  • empregos permitidos para interagir com o NPC (é possível que não haja empregos, basta deixar em branco).

[Otimização]

Este script é totalmente otimizado.

Testado com 350 NPCs:

  • Parado: 0,03-0,04 ms;
  • Perto de um NPC: 0,07 – 0,12 ms.
Categoria:
Etiquetas:

O problema: NPCs sem vida repetindo as mesmas falas ou percorrendo caminhos previsíveis quebram a imersão em RPG e servidores PvE dinâmicos.

A solução de IA: Integre IA, particularmente modelos de Processamento de Linguagem Natural (PLN), para dar aos NPCs um comportamento mais dinâmico e crível. Imagine NPCs que podem:

  • Participe de conversas mais naturais e contextualizadas (indo além de simples gatilhos de palavras-chave).
  • Reaja dinamicamente ao estado do mundo (por exemplo, comente sobre eventos recentes, clima ou ações de jogadores próximos).
  • Exiba comportamentos e rotinas mais complexos, potencialmente lembrando de interações passadas com jogadores.
  • Forneça dicas dinâmicas, missões ou informações com base nas narrativas do servidor em evolução.

Recursos e considerações:

  • Serviços como o okok TalkToNPC visam aproveitar a IA para gerar diálogos com NPCs.
  • A integração de IA avançada de NPCs geralmente exige um esforço significativo de script e possíveis chamadas de API externas (o que pode ter implicações de desempenho e custo).
  • Comece pequeno: melhore os principais PNJs (como fornecedores de missões ou vendedores) antes de tentar uma reformulação em todo o servidor.

O Objetivo: Faça com que o mundo do jogo pareça menos um palco estático e mais um ambiente vivo e pulsante que reage aos jogadores.

PedGPT

PedGPT é um projeto que utiliza IA inteligente (como a tecnologia por trás do ChatGPT) para fazer com que as pessoas que circulam (pedestres) no jogo Grand Theft Auto V (GTA V) ajam de forma muito mais inteligente e parecida com pessoas reais. O objetivo é tornar o jogo mais divertido e interessante, com personagens que pensam e reagem de forma criativa. Ele se conecta ao jogo por meio de uma ferramenta chamada FiveM. Além disso, é código aberto, o que significa que qualquer um pode olhar o código ou ajudar a construí-lo.

Você também pode conferir este projeto chamado PedGPT


4. Otimize o desempenho e a estabilidade com análise preditiva

O problema: Atrasos inesperados no servidor, travamentos ou degradação do desempenho podem prejudicar a experiência do jogador e ser difíceis de diagnosticar de forma reativa.

A solução de IA: Embora a IA não consiga prever magicamente todos os acidentes, ela se destaca na análise de padrões em dados. Ao alimentar logs e desempenho do servidor métricas (uso de CPU/RAM, contagem de jogadores, tempos de script, latência de rede) em modelos analíticos, você pode:

  • Identifique horários de pico de uso e gargalos de recursos para informar atualizações de hardware ou ajustes de configuração.
  • Detecte correlações entre scripts ou eventos específicos e períodos de alta carga ou instabilidade do servidor.
  • Preveja o potencial esgotamento de recursos com base nas tendências dos jogadores, permitindo reinicializações proativas ou dimensionamento.
  • Identifique padrões de erros recorrentes que podem indicar bugs subjacentes em scripts ou configurações.

Como funciona: Isso envolve a configuração de registro e monitoramento robustos e, em seguida, o uso de ferramentas de análise de dados ou scripts personalizados (potencialmente incorporando bibliotecas de aprendizado de máquina) para encontrar padrões e anomalias significativas ao longo do tempo.

Exemplo prático: Um administrador de servidor usou análise de log para descobrir que picos severos de lag ocorriam consistentemente quando uma combinação específica de atividades do jogador e eventos de script aconteciam simultaneamente. Isso permitiu que eles otimizassem o script problemático e agendassem eventos intensivos em recursos de forma mais inteligente, melhorando significativamente a estabilidade.


5. Acelere o desenvolvimento com a criação de conteúdo assistida por IA

O problema: Criar novos conteúdos envolventes — mapas, missões, scripts, veículos, itens — consome muito tempo dos desenvolvedores.

A solução de IA: A IA pode atuar como um assistente poderoso no pipeline de desenvolvimento, ajudando com:

  • Geração de ideias e brainstorming: Use ferramentas de IA como ChatGPT para gerar linhas de missões, conceitos de eventos, histórias de personagens ou variações de diálogos com base no tema e na tradição do seu servidor. (Veja nosso Guia de Prompt do ChatGPT!)
  • Assistência e otimização de código: A IA pode ajudar a escrever trechos de código padrão (Lua, JS, C#), depurar scripts existentes sugerindo possíveis correções, traduzir comentários de código ou oferecer sugestões de otimização. (Novamente, verifique o Guia rápido e ferramentas como nosso Script Optimizer).
  • Geração de ativos (emergentes): As ferramentas de IA são cada vez mais capazes de gerar texturas, arte conceitual ou até mesmo variações básicas de modelos 3D. Embora muitas vezes exijam refinamento humano, isso pode acelerar os estágios iniciais da criação de ativos.
  • Ideias para design de mapas e níveis: A IA pode analisar dados de mapas do mundo real ou layouts existentes para sugerir pontos de interesse interessantes, redes rodoviárias ou posicionamento de edifícios para mapas personalizados.

Nota importante: A IA é uma ferramenta para aumentar a criatividade e a eficiência do desenvolvedor, não substituí-la inteiramente. O código gerado pela IA precisa de testes completos, e os ativos gerados normalmente exigem retoques artísticos.


Perguntas frequentes

P: Implementar IA é difícil ou caro? R: Varia. Chatbots simples ou usar IA para geração de texto podem ser relativamente fáceis e de baixo custo (algumas ferramentas são gratuitas ou de código aberto). Anti-cheat comportamental avançado ou IA NPC profundamente integrada exigem conhecimento técnico significativo e custos potencialmente contínuos para APIs ou poder de processamento. Comece com projetos gerenciáveis.

P: A IA pode impactar negativamente o desempenho do servidor? R: Potencialmente, sim. Scripts de IA mal otimizados ou dependência excessiva de APIs externas podem introduzir latência ou aumentar o uso de recursos. Sempre teste completamente em um ambiente de não produção e monitore o impacto no desempenho após a implantação.

P: Os jogadores sentirão que estão interagindo com bots? R: Uma boa implementação de IA deve parecer perfeita. Um bot de suporte útil é melhor do que nenhum suporte. NPCs mais inteligentes aumentam a imersão. Um anti-cheat bem ajustado funciona de forma invisível. O objetivo é melhorar a experiência do jogador, não fazer o servidor parecer artificial.

P: Por onde devo começar com a integração de IA? R: Comece pelas áreas de maior impacto e menor risco. Automatizar o suporte com um chatbot (como nossa ferramenta gratuita) costuma ser um ótimo primeiro passo. Usar IA para brainstorming de desenvolvimento ou assistência de código também apresenta riscos relativamente baixos.


Pronto para atualizar seu servidor com IA? Seu caminho a seguir

Integrar a IA não precisa ser uma reformulação complexa. Siga estes passos para uma transição mais tranquila:

  1. Identifique seu maior ponto de dor: São consultas de suporte repetitivas? Trapaceiros? Falta de conteúdo dinâmico? Concentre seus esforços iniciais aí.
  2. Comece pequeno e teste completamente: Implemente uma solução de IA primeiro, como uma ferramenta de suporte de IA FiveM. Teste-a rigorosamente em um servidor de desenvolvimento ou durante horários de menor movimento.
  3. Colete feedback e repita: Monitore o impacto da IA. Ela resolve o problema? Ela introduz novos problemas? Colete feedback do jogador e refine a implementação.
  4. Escalar gradualmente: Quando estiver confortável com uma solução, considere encarar o próximo desafio da sua lista, seja explorar opções antitrapaça da IA ou aprimorar NPCs importantes.

O objetivo final é alavancar a IA para criar um servidor FiveM mais estável, envolvente e gerenciado de forma eficiente. Deixe a IA lidar com as tarefas tediosas, liberando você para focar na visão criativa e na construção de comunidade que tornam seu servidor único.


PS: Não deixe seu servidor ficar para trás. Aproveite o poder da IA para aprimorar sua comunidade e se destacar da multidão – comece a explorar essas possibilidades hoje mesmo.

Lucas
Lucas

Eu sou Luke, sou um gamer e adoro escrever sobre FiveM, GTA e roleplay. Eu administro uma comunidade de roleplay e tenho cerca de 10 anos de experiência em administração de servidores.

Artigos: 570

Deixe um comentário